The two-volume CIC Caprinae Atlas of the World describes 96 Caprinae phenotypes, contains 130 detailed, full color distribution maps and more than 1,000 color photos from the wild and from collections of important museums in North America and Europe. The monumental work highlights the importance of science in connection with sustainable hunting and achieves the all-important conservation connection of field research, effective management, community involvement and sustainable hunting. Bodo Meier, a well-known German aquarellist, was specially commissioned to illustrate the dust covers of the standard edition of the CIC Caprinae Atlas of the World with a watercolor painting of a Pamir Argali group and a group of magnificent Kashmir markhor. MCGUIRE & HINES STUDIOS: Long-time DSC supporter, Life Member and exhibitor - Internationally Collected - Jan Martin McGuire - artist, naturalist and conservationist - is pleased to partner for the first-time with sculptor John Lewton to present this unique and exciting collaborative bronze and acrylic work for auction. Lewton, well-known in the wild goat and sheep hunting industry, has guided and participated in hunts all over the world. He is also a taxidermist which gives him incredible insight into the anatomy and behavior of these animals. Jan and her husband James Gary Hines II - nature photographer - have invited Lewton to exhibit with them at their booth this year as a guest sculptor. Jan likes to paint what she has experienced herself. However, when it is a subject she has not seen in the wild, she will do extensive research, anywhere from conferring with scientists, to having in-depth conversations with hunters and looking at their photos/video footage. The painting portrayed in this montage is an example of artwork commissioned by Corey Knowlton. Jan worked closely with him, reviewing videos and studying the body structure and coloration of a Sindh Ibex. She obtained this same sculpture from Lewton and it is the favorite in her collection of bronzes. The form and beauty of the sculpture inspired Jan to create a painting exclusively to go with this collaboration. 2016 DSC ARTIST OF THE YEAR, LAUREL BARBIERI, is pleased to present this fascinating work of art for auction in support of DSC. The beauty and mystery of ancient cave paintings is captured in primitive, yet contemporary, acrylic paint and gesso on Masonite board in "Battle", an original Relief Sculpture. The Relief Sculpture process originated by the artist used to create "Battle", results in a powerful multi-dimensional work that pulsates with color and depth. In this piece, Barbieri depicts the battle-worn bull elk's exhaustion and elation having survived another rutting season. This painting reflects the artist's close connection to the land, a result of her childhood years growing up in simple circumstances in the rugged Olympic Mountains of western Washington State. This affinity was further developed by her hunting and exploring adventures as an adult. Barbieri's art is filled with organic shapes, heavy textures, brilliant colors, movement, and emotion. The AMERICAN CUSTOM GUNMAKERS GUILD (ACGG) is pleased to offer for auction a .338 Winchester Magnum in a stalking rifle theme. This 2016 DSC President's rifle is based on a US Repeating Arms, Winchester Model 70 barreled action. The control round feed action and barrel were extensively refined to enhance beauty and function. The rifle features open sights, custom scope bases, custom bottom metal, and straight bolt handle with engraved knob. The stock is excellent English Walnut of classic design with inlet rear swivel, ebony forend tip, leather covered recoil pad, oil finish and point pattern checkering with mulled border. In all, eight ACGG specialists contributed to the production of this exquisite rifle, a fitting example in the art of fine gunmaking.
